As of 13-Aug, Signet Industries Ltd is currently priced at 55.15, reflecting an increase of 0.95 or 1.75%. The stock has shown a trend reversal by gaining after three consecutive days of decline, outperforming its sector by 0.85%. However, it is trading below its 5-day, 20-day, 50-day, 100-day, and 200-day moving averages, indicating a generally bearish trend. Over the past month, the stock has declined by 12.53%, and its year-to-date performance shows a significant drop of 23.19%. Despite these declines, the company has an attractive valuation with a return on capital employed (ROCE) of 12.6 and is trading at a discount compared to its peers. However, it faces challenges such as a high debt-to-EBITDA ratio of 4.08, which indicates a low ability to service debt, and a modest growth rate in net sales and operating profit over the last five years.

In the broader market context, the Sensex has experienced a slight decline of 0.01% over the past week, while Signet Industries has shown a more pronounced drop in its short-term performance. The stock's year-to-date return of -23.19% starkly contrasts with the Sensex's positive return of 3.07%, highlighting its underperformance relative to the market. This underperformance is further emphasized by the stock's negative returns over the past year and its inability to generate significant shareholder value, as indicated by a low average return on equity of 6.18%. Overall, while there are some positive factors such as attractive valuation metrics, the stock's recent price movement is primarily influenced by its ongoing struggles with profitability and debt management.
